Genetic Stability Markers

Genetic stability markers are observable traits and molecular indicators breeders use to assess consistency across generations of a cultivar. These markers help distinguish stable, true-breeding lines from unstable or heterozygous populations. Common markers include morphological consistency (leaf shape, flowering time, plant structure), terpene profiles, and cannabinoid ratios that remain uniform across seed or clone batches. Modern breeding programs increasingly employ molecular techniques to verify genetic identity and stability before release. Understanding these markers is essential for maintaining cultivar integrity and predicting offspring uniformity in both commercial and research settings.

Breeder relevance

Breeders rely on stability markers to confirm that a line breeds true and produces predictable offspring. These indicators guide selection pressure and help identify when further stabilization work is needed before commercial release.
